Expert Tips for Success
To elevate your Egg Roll In a Bowl experience, here are some expert tips to keep in mind:
– Make sure to julienne the carrots thinly for quick and even cooking.
– Adjust the seasoning according to your taste preferences by adding more soy sauce or vinegar as needed.
– For a touch of sweetness, you can sprinkle some brown sugar or honey into the dish.
– To save time, you can use pre-shredded cabbage and pre-minced garlic from the grocery store.
– Feel free to add other vegetables like bell peppers, mushrooms, or snap peas for added color and nutrition.
Variations and Substitutions
If you’re looking to switch things up or accommodate specific dietary preferences, here are some creative variations and ingredient substitutions you can try:
– For a spicy kick, add a dash of sriracha or chili paste to the dish.
– Swap out the traditional cabbage for Napa cabbage or bok choy for a different flavor profile.
– Use ground chicken or tofu instead of the usual ground pork for a lighter alternative.
– Experiment with different seasonings like Chinese five-spice powder or red pepper flakes for a unique twist.
– Include diced water chestnuts or bamboo shoots for added texture and authenticity.

Easy Low Carb Egg Roll In a Bowl Recipe Ready in 20 Minutes
A flavorful and satisfying low-carb dish that combines Asian-inspired flavors in a simple stir-fry. This Egg Roll In a Bowl recipe is quick to make, versatile, and packed with wholesome ingredients.
Ingredients
- 1 pound ground meat (such as turkey, chicken, pork, or beef)
- 1 small head cabbage, shredded
- 2 large carrots, julienned
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on ginger, grated
- 1/4 cup soy sauce (or tamari for a gluten-free option)
- 2 tablespoons sesame oil
- 2 tablespoons rice vinegar
- 3 green onions, sliced
- Salt and pepper to taste
Directions
-
In a large skillet or wok, brown the ground meat over medium heat until fully cooked.
-
Add the minced garlic and grated ginger to the meat, and sauté for a minute until fragrant.
-
Toss in the shredded cabbage and julienned carrots, and stir-fry for a few minutes until the vegetables are tender-crisp.
-
Drizzle the soy sauce, sesame oil, and rice vinegar over the mixture, and season with salt and pepper to taste. Stir well to combine all the ingredients.
-
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together.
-
Remove the skillet from the heat and garnish with sliced green onions for a fresh burst of flavor.
-
Serve the Egg Roll In a Bowl hot and enjoy the delicious medley of flavors and textures!
